Summary

Remote Role Eastern Timezone
 

PRIMARY FUNCTION: The Talent Acquisition, Systems, & Onboarding Manager is responsible for developing, planning, organizing and directing all aspects of a full life cycle recruitment strategy and initiatives.  Provide subject matter expertise in all staffing policies and processes for non-clinical recruitment, systems, and onboarding processes. 

 

  1. Responsible for the full life cycle recruitment of executive, management, administrative, medical, and technical positions throughout the company.
  2. Develop and maintain effective recruitment strategy. This may include job posting optimization, recruiting marketing channel development, job board procurement, digital and non-digital employment marketing, comprehensive recruitment campaign planning, talent planning, etc.
  3. Supervise and develop talent acquisition team to effectively manage and support recruiting process and initiatives.
  4. Develop recruitment strategies and initiatives to achieve and maintain required staffing levels throughout organization.
  5. Drive process improvement across Talent Acquisition, inclusive of evaluating systems and processes to align with growing the enterprise function to scale nationally.  
  6. Lead and develop onboarding processes and systems, evaluating new vendors, and building hi8gh performance teams in an agile ever changing environment to ensure best in class candidate and hiring leader experiences

Education: Bachelor’s Deg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, Education or related field. Commensurate work or military experience can be substituted for education.

Licensure/Certification: None

Experience: At least three years of recruitment management experience in a corporate or business setting, preferably in human resources, personnel or administration, and/or healthcare environment.

Knowledge, Skills & Abilities: Knowledge of HR laws and regulations related to the training and recruitment. Ability to manage multiple and completing tasks and prioritizes with flexibility, ownership and reliable follow-up. Analytical and problem-solving skills. Excellent oral and written communication skills. The Training and Development Manager must be skilled in developing and conducting training programs, evaluations, assessments, surveys; have knowledge of learning principles and training techniques; knowledge of state/federal requirements. Also important is the ability to communicate effectively with the management team, and at all levels of the organization. Proven ability to lead by example and foster mentoring relationships. Outstanding verbal, written, multi-tasking and presentation skills
